Greek mythology? From Earth. Although the Romans calling Odysseus Ulysses might just be them importing the story....

Scylla is a monster paired with a second monster Charibdis(spelling?) that menaced sailors in a narrow passage. One was a monster perched on rocks that would pull sailors off the boats to eat them, the other was a massive whirlpool that would crush the ships. And there was no other way through, in the story, so you had to pick which of the evils you sailed closer to.
